====== SHICCal ======
====== Setup ======
===== Prerequisite =====
* SHIC software must be reside in your root directory. C:\SHICrivm
* UAView software
* All ### should be changed to the respective instrument number
===== Processing UV data =====
The UV data must first be process before SHIC is able to ingest the data.
- Place the UV file and the corresponding UVR file inside the same directory, IE: C:\SHICrivm\uvdata\###
- Run the UA Scan program and process one UV file at a time. **Note: once you click process, you must highlight one scan, then press SaveScans**
- Run the following .bat file to rename the processed files (removed _YY from the end) @@echo off
setlocal enabledelayedexpansion
set /p brewer="Enter Brewer #: "
set "folder=C:\SHICrivm\uvdata\%brewer%"
for %%a in ("%folder%\*_*.%brewer%") do (
set "oldname=%%~nxa"
set "newname=!oldname:_=!"
ren "%%a" "!newname!"
)
- Inside C:\SHICrivm\uvanalys, create a file, ###.dfa with the following inside.
ozonshi.dfa
0 no_id_met
.###
c:\shicrivm\uvdata\###\
285.00 440.00 0.50
1
0
0.550
1
1.0
- Launch SHICcall5_25.exe
- Set the instrument_ID to ### and the DAYtime to which ever you files you'd like to prcoess
- Click Run SHIC
**Note: there is a __shicrivm.log__ inside the SHICCall directory that can help troubleshoot any issues
====== Functions ======
Spectral shifts - Helps determines any shift to the instrument, can help point to bad HG bulbs/DSP applied. Should be within +/- 0.1nm\\
Spectral spikes - shows if there is any issues with the instrument measuring. should be within +/- 10 percent after 310nm
